Dear Parents,
The Madison Russian School will be offering Dance classes starting with the next quarter! This quarter, classes will begin on March 19th and will continue through June 4th (the dance lessons are on Sundays). There will be no classes on April 16th and April 23rd due to the Catholic and Russian Orthodox Easter holidays. Dance lessons will be held in the upstairs dance studio at in the Madtown Twister building located at 7035 Old Sauk Rd, Madison. The instructor is planning on separating interested children into two age groups: 5-8 years old and 8+ years old. The younger group will meet from 10 — 11 AM, and the older group will meet from 11:15 AM — 12:45 PM. All children should wear ballet shoes (sold in many of the local stores, for example, Wal-Mart) and comfortable clothing. The Russian-speaking instructor is planning to teach the children choreography, folk dances, and prepare theatrical dance skits. We are planning on having regular performances by the children. The instructor completed the Latvian Pedagogical University, specializing as a Teacher of Dance. She has completed “baletnuyu hudozhestvennuyu studiyu” and Folk-Dance courses. For 11 years, she danced in the “Vdohnovenie” ensemble. She has experience working with pre-school and school-age children. We are very pleased to have her on our staff! Tuition costs for the 10 lessons in this quarter will be: $80 for the younger children’s class $120 for the older children’s class Children who are new to our school will need to pay the $10 Annual Fee to the School Fund as well. Please join FRUA-WI in a cultural celebration… our 14th annual YARMARKA Sunday, September 16, 2007 Konkel Park, Greenfield, WI 11:30-3:00 Going to a festival brings a SMILE to everyone’s face! Open markets date back to the middle ages and are still popular throughout Russia, Ukraine, and Eastern Europe. Music, food, games, entertainment, and shopping are all part of FRUA-WI’s YARMARKA . There will be smiles all around as your family experiences the culture of your child’s birth country.
